Summary
Adverse reactions to human plasma proteins can range from mild to fatal. This review discusses the immunological processes and management strategies for these common blood product reactions.

Background:
- Adverse reactions to human plasma proteins are a significant concern in transfusion medicine.
- Reactions can vary from mild urticaria to life-threatening anaphylaxis.
- These reactions are associated with various blood products, including whole blood, fresh frozen plasma, and human immune serum globulin.

Main Results:
- Adverse reactions can occur with almost any blood product.
- Common scenarios include whole blood transfusion in naive recipients and plasma/immune serum globulin administration in immunodeficient patients.
- Understanding the immunological basis is crucial for effective management.
